Feature management of a communication device

Title: Feature management of a communication device

The Patent Description & Claims data below is from USPTO Patent Application 20090006116, Feature management of a communication device.


1. A system for managing in real-time a communication device used by a user on a communication network, comprising: a policy decider for storing a list of policies that control one or more features or functions associated with the communication device and for automatically deciding to accept or deny a request sent to or from the communication device to perform the features or functions based on the list of policies, the list of policies including a policy for managing content that can be sent, received, or used by the communication device; and a policy enforcer for communicating the request to the policy decider and enforcing a decision by the policy decider as to whether the request has been accepted or denied by either notifying the user of the denied request and taking one or more actions consistent with the denied request or taking one or more actions consistent with the accepted request.

2. The system as recited in claim 1, wherein the policy establishes a total prohibition on content that can be sent, received, or used.

3. The system as recited in claim 1, wherein the policy establishes a quantity limit on content that can be sent, received or used in a given period of time.

4. The system as recited in claim 1, wherein the policy establishes a limit on how many units of value can be spent by the user on content that can be sent, received, or used in a given period of time.

5. The system as recited in claim 4, wherein the communication device is managed by an administrator, and wherein the policy enforcer notifies the administrator, the user or both the administrator and the user when the limit on how many units of value can be spent by the user has been reached.

6. The system as recited in claim 1, wherein the policy establishes a limit on a type of content that can be sent, received, or used.

7. The system as recited in claim 6, wherein the limit on a type of content is determined by a filter that reviews content that can be sent, received, or used.

8. The system as recited in claim 7, wherein the filter is established and managed by the administrator.

9. The system as recited in claim 7, wherein the filter is established and managed by a third party.

10. The system as recited in claim 1, wherein the policy establishes a time frame during which it is acceptable to send, receive, or use the content.

11. The system as recited in claim 10, wherein the list of policies includes a user established list of policies and an administrator established list of policies, and wherein the administrator established list of policies can take precedence over the user established list of policies.
